Subject: Key rotation — resizr-cli

Heads up: the batch key for resizr-cli (our image resize CLI) rotated tonight per the quarterly schedule. Old key dies at 06:00 UTC. Any cron jobs on the Farrowmede runners still using the cached credential will start throwing 401s after that. Update the env var, re-run the smoke batch, confirm output counts match. Escalate to the Pipelines channel only if resize throughput drops. New key follows.

gateway credential: kto23_LX9A4ys6i4nzHtpOLNLodKK

# Break-Glass: Catalog Cache Invalidation

Scope: the Pinrow product catalog at Veldstone Retail. If stale prices persist after a purge and the Hollowmere invalidation queue is wedged, use break-glass to flush the edge tier directly. Contractors: get verbal sign-off from the catalog lead first. Steps: open the Hollowmere admin shell, select emergency-flush, confirm the tenant, and run it once — repeated flushes thrash the origin. Access is logged and expires after 20 minutes. Unseal the admin shell with the passphrase below.

recovery phrase for kahop-tajog: istix-casvan

## Changelog — Tidemark Widget 3.2

Defaults changed. Read before touching anything.

- Refresh interval now hourly, not every 15 min. Harbor feeds from the Pellisport aggregator throttle aggressive polling.
- Lunar-offset correction is on by default. Disable only for legacy Kestrel Bay deployments.
- Chart units default to metric. The imperial fallback flag is deprecated and will be removed in 3.4.
- Cache eviction is now time-based, not size-based.

New installs should start from the default configuration values listed below.

config for kahap-taweg:
oliox:
  pin: 8609
  tenant: casath
  seal: seal_632a4a6f
  metrics_host: metrics.oliox.nelvrogrid.example
  standby_team: keleth
  escalation: briiel-oliwyn
  nonce: e2397c

**Vendor note: Inkmill markdown pipeline**

Rendering for Parchway docs is outsourced to Inkmill under an annual contract, renewing each March. They handle sanitization and PDF export; we own the upload queue. SLA: 4-hour response on rendering failures. Escalate only after two failed retries. Their support desk is reachable at the address below.

billing contact of hahaf-baguf = zorael.tammir.jorius@sivrelhq.internal